Title Race heated up in 2Bundesliga

The title race in the second division in Germany heats up as the top four teams are all on 42 points. 


La Liga, Serie A, Bundesliga, and Ligue 1 all have an exciting title race in store for football fans but none of them have a points table as congested as 2.Bundesliga. Hamburger FC, Furth, VLF Bochum, Holstein Kiel all are on 42 points at the top of the table. Not only that but the teams are separated based on goal difference which could change in a single game as the 1st and 4th teams are only separated by a GD of 5. Karlsruher are 5th with 36 points along with Dusseldorf who wear relegated from the Bundesliga last season. Both the teams could still end up getting promoted with 12 games still left to play.


The top 4 teams tied on 42 points have been in splendid form this season. Hamburger FC missed out on a playoff spot by just one point last season. But in their second consecutive season in the 2nd division, the German side has been consistent so far this season thanks to the league’s top scorer Simon Terodde. Holstein Kiel pulled off a major upset earlier this season when they knocked out treble winners Bayern Munich on penalties in the second round of the DFB Pokal cup. Furth has only played 1 season in the top flight this century and has shown this season that they want another bite at the cherry. VFL Bochum was considered a yo-yo club between 1994 and 2011 bouncing between the top 2 divisions of the german tier. But ever since getting relegated in 2010 the club has failed to earn a promotion but on the bright side, they have managed to stay in the 2.Bundesliga. This year they are in a great position to go back to the big league after 11 years.


The lower divisions of England, Germany, Italy, and Spain are always said to be very competitive as both promotion and relegation are never too far off. Notting Forrest in the last Championship season missed out on a play-offs place only on Goal Difference that too on the last day. Between 2007 and 2017 Sunderland were considered a premier league quality club but after back to back relegations in 2017 and 2018 the English side is in the middle of the 3rd division. Such instances are normal in the lower divisions where the quality of football might be a level lower but the drive and desire bring the excitement.
